Security deposits are a crucial subject for anyone who rents out their property or is thinking of doing so.

First, it’s important to realize that you can only take one month’s security deposit in the state of Hawaii. The same goes for the pet deposit. At our company, we scale the pet deposit based on the size and breed of the animal.

For pets over 50 lbs, the tenant will be charged a deposit between $800 to $1,000. We also require that the tenant take out an additional $10,000 liability policy if the animal is categorized as a “dangerous breed.”

For pets or otherwise, security deposits are intended to ensure that no damage befalls your property. In the state of Hawaii, security deposits are used specifically for damage—not for rent. A tenant who breaks their lease cannot just forfeit their security deposit in lieu of rent.

WHAT ARE G.E. TAXES?

Have you heard of G.E. taxes? Here’s what you need to know about them.

I have a somewhat serious topic to talk to you about this month. It’s general excise taxes, also known as GE taxes here in Hawaii.

In order to do business in Hawaii as a property owner, your rental becomes a business and is susceptible to a 4.5% GE tax. You are required to fill out a BB-1 application form, get your general excise tax number, and register it with the state department of taxation.

IS THE OWNER OR TENANT RESPONSIBLE FOR PEST CONTROL?

Who is responsible for pest control costs in a landlord-tenant situation? Here’s the rundown.

This week, we’re talking about pest control. I always get asked, “Who is responsible for pest control in the home?”

For all you owners out there, know that it’s your responsibility for the first 10 days that a tenant is in your house. After that, it’s their burden. If they move in and there is an infestation, you will have to treat it. However, if they find roaches 90 days in, it’s likely that they brought them in when they moved.

Our leases state that the pest control costs after 10 days are shouldered by the tenant. Rat problems are a little bit different. There are certain neighborhoods in Honolulu that have more of them than others. When we get into that kind of situation, we address it with the owner beforehand.

WHY DO WE REQUIRE TENANTS TO FILL OUT A PROPERTY CONDITION FORM?

When it comes to property management, my job really comes down to two things: protecting your home and putting money in your account.

This is why we require all tenants to fill out the Property Condition form within 10 days of their move-in date. Unless they complete that form, the property cannot be properly addressed each month.

If the tenant sees anything that isn’t working or is damaged when they move in, we ask them to make note of it on this form. This way, we have a record of the property’s condition at the time they moved in.

Having tenants sign this form is a huge part of how we protect your property. Not only do we require tenants to fill out this form, we also require our property managers to walk through the form with the tenants. The Property Condition form becomes a guide for us during the tenant’s time at your property.

In other words, if the tenant damages something on your property after moving in and filling out the form, we already have a record of your property’s condition proving the damage was not preexisting. Any damage that occurs on your property after the form is completed will be repaired at the tenant’s expense.
